About Kim Thayil

📖 Summary

Kim Thayil is an American musician best known as the lead guitarist for the iconic rock band Soundgarden. His distinctive playing style, characterized by heavy, intricate riffs and psychedelic textures, has made him one of the most influential guitarists in the alternative rock and grunge scenes of the 1990s.

Born in Seattle, Washington, in 1960, Thayil was raised in a family of Indian immigrants. His early exposure to Indian classical music, as well as his fascination with heavy metal and punk rock, greatly influenced his musical development. He formed his first band in high school and eventually met bassist Hiro Yamamoto and singer Chris Cornell, with whom he would form Soundgarden in 1984.

Soundgarden quickly gained a following in the local Seattle music scene, and Thayil's innovative guitar work was a key element in the band's sound. His use of unconventional tunings and off-kilter rhythms, combined with an affinity for volume and distortion, set Soundgarden apart from their contemporaries. Thayil's guitar playing was instrumental in shaping the band's early albums, such as "Ultramega OK" and "Louder Than Love," and helped establish them as pioneers of the emerging grunge movement.

As Soundgarden rose to prominence in the late '80s and early '90s, Thayil's guitar playing became synonymous with the band's success. His contributions to the band's breakthrough album, "Badmotorfinger," and their seminal work, "Superunknown," showcased his ability to blend heavy, muscular riffing with intricate, melodic leads. Songs like "Rusty Cage" and "Black Hole Sun" were defined by Thayil's creative guitar work, which pushed the boundaries of traditional rock and metal.

What ethnicity is Kim Thayil?

Childhood and early life. Born in Seattle in 1960, Thayil grew up in the Chicago suburb of Park Forest. His parents came from the state of Kerala in India to Seattle.


What kind of guitar does Kim Thayil play?

USA Artist Edition S-100 Polara Kim Thayil Crafted to Kim's preferred specs and measurements, these guitars replicate the essence of Kim's cherished '78 S-100, boasting an Old-Growth Honduran Mahogany body and neck, adorned with a Guild 70's headstock and neck shape.


Who replaced Chris Cornell in Soundgarden?

Cornell switched to rhythm guitar in 1985, replaced on drums initially by Scott Sundquist, and later by Matt Cameron in 1986. Yamamoto left in 1990 and was replaced initially by Jason Everman and shortly thereafter by Ben Shepherd. The band dissolved in 1997 and re-formed in 2010.
